Kenneth F. Wiley

Staff WorkerLos Alamos, NM

Manhattan Project VeteranProject Worker/Staff

Kenneth Wiley was a staff worker at Los Alamos during the Manhattan Project. Prior to joining, he worked in California building ships for the war effort. He stayed on after the war to work at the Los Alamos Scientific Laboratory. Wiley died on October 25, 2007.

 

Kenneth F. Wiley’s Timeline
1920 Sep 18th Born in Traver, California.

19441960 Worked at Los Alamos.

2007 Oct 25th Died.
